FIFA to open summer transfer window from 1 to 10 June

FIFA wants to promote the new Club World Cup and therefore, to allow clubs to strengthen their squad, it is going to open the summer transfer window from 1 to 10 June. It will reopen from 1 July.

FIFA has made a surprising decision regarding the summer transfer window. The supranational body has decided to open the next summer transfer window from 1 to 10 June 2025, according to 'Marca'.
The idea is to boost and encourage the movement of players ahead of the 2025 Club World Cup, which will begin on 15 June and end on 13 July when the players' contracts have expired.
The fact that it will be played in two different years forces FIFA to enable this new window to either sign players or to renew them, so that they will not be exposed without contracts from 1 July. This new window will only be for teams participating in the Club World Cup, provided that their federations give the go-ahead for this new initiative.
In this way, clubs taking part in the World Cup will be able to sign players to be at the event and will also be able to renew, just for a few days if they wish, the contracts of players whose contracts expire on 30 June.
